On November 14, in Ha Nha commune, Da Nang city, the Da Nang Red Cross Society coordinated with the Vietnam Fatherland Front Committee of Da Nang city, Hospital 199 - Ministry of Public Security, Saigon Song Han Eye Hospital and volunteer groups to organize a humanitarian program for people who suffered heavy losses due to floods. The total support value is more than 778 million VND.

In the program, 200 households in Ha Nha commune received gifts including 10kg of rice, 1 box of instant noodles and 1 towel. In addition, 500 boxes of instant noodles and 510 towels, 200 blankets, diapers for adults and children of all kinds... were handed over to the Vietnam Fatherland Front Committee and the Red Cross Society of Ha Nha commune to continue distributing to households facing difficulties.
In addition, 430 boxes of household goods supported by ASEAN (including personal hygiene boxes, kitchen appliance boxes and essential items) worth more than 347 million VND were also given to households that suffered heavy damage.
In parallel with the gift-giving activity, the medical team of Hospital 199 - Ministry of Public Security and Saigon Song Han Eye Hospital provided free health check-ups, consultations and medicine to 200 people, focusing on common diseases after floods such as respiratory diseases, dermatology, eye diseases and chronic diseases. The total value of drugs and medical services is 150 million VND.
